Understanding Quad Exhaust Systems
Before diving into the upgrade process, it’s important to understand what a quad exhaust system is and why it appeals to so many enthusiasts. A quad exhaust system features four exhaust tips, often arranged with two on each side of the rear bumper. This design not only creates an aggressive, sporty aesthetic but also offers potential performance benefits by improving exhaust flow and reducing backpressure.
Many modern performance cars and muscle cars come equipped with quad exhausts from the factory, but aftermarket upgrades can further enhance sound quality, increase horsepower, and even improve fuel efficiency in some cases. By upgrading to a high-quality quad exhaust system, you can achieve a deeper, throatier exhaust note, better throttle response, and a more distinctive look that sets your vehicle apart.
Key Factors to Consider When Choosing a DIY Quad Exhaust Kit
Choosing the right DIY quad exhaust kit requires careful consideration of several important factors to ensure compatibility, quality, and ease of installation.
Vehicle Compatibility
Not all exhaust kits are universal. Many kits are designed to fit specific vehicle makes and models, so the first step is to verify that the kit you’re interested in will work with your car. Check the manufacturer’s specifications and look for fitment guides or customer reviews to confirm compatibility. Some universal kits offer adjustable components, but these may require more customization during installation.
Material Quality
The materials used in the exhaust system greatly impact durability, corrosion resistance, and overall performance. Stainless steel is the most recommended material for DIY exhaust kits due to its excellent resistance to rust, heat, and wear. Some kits may use aluminized steel or mild steel, which are less expensive but more prone to corrosion over time.
Sound Characteristics
Each exhaust system produces a unique sound profile. Consider whether you want a loud, aggressive tone or a more subtle, refined sound. Manufacturers often provide audio samples or descriptions of the exhaust note. Reading user feedback or watching video reviews can help you get a better sense of the sound before making a purchase.
Installation Complexity
Some quad exhaust kits are designed for bolt-on installation, meaning they can be installed with basic hand tools and no modifications. Others may require welding, cutting, or fabrication, which can add complexity and require specialized tools. Assess your own mechanical skills and available tools before choosing a kit to avoid frustration during installation.
Included Components and Instructions
A good DIY kit should come complete with all necessary components such as mufflers, pipes, hangers, clamps, and tips. Clear, detailed instructions or installation manuals are essential for guiding you through each step. Some kits also include additional hardware like gaskets and heat shields.
Budget
Prices for quad exhaust kits vary widely based on brand, materials, and features. Set a budget before shopping and aim for the best quality you can afford. Remember that a higher upfront cost for a durable, well-designed kit can save money in the long run by reducing maintenance needs and enhancing longevity.

Step-by-Step Installation Guide for DIY Quad Exhaust Upgrades
Installing a quad exhaust system at home can be a rewarding project if approached methodically. Here’s a detailed step-by-step guide to help you through the process:
1. Gather Tools and Materials
- Socket set and wrenches
- Jack and jack stands or a hydraulic lift
- Exhaust hanger removal tool
- WD-40 or penetrating oil
- Safety goggles and gloves
- Torque wrench
- Exhaust sealant or gaskets (if required)
- Cutting tools or grinder (if modifications are necessary)
2. Prepare Your Vehicle
Park your vehicle on a flat, stable surface. Use a jack to lift the car and secure it safely on jack stands. Never work under a vehicle supported only by a jack. Allow the exhaust system to cool if the vehicle was recently driven.
3. Remove the Old Exhaust System
Spray penetrating oil on all bolts and hangers to loosen rust and debris. Carefully unbolt the existing exhaust components, starting from the rear and moving forward. Use the exhaust hanger tool to remove the pipes from rubber hangers. Take care not to damage any sensors or wiring.
4. Test Fit the New Exhaust Components
Before final installation, loosely assemble the new quad exhaust components under the vehicle to ensure proper alignment and fitment. Adjust pipe lengths or angles as necessary, especially for universal kits.
5. Install the New Exhaust System
Starting at the front, attach the new exhaust pipes to the catalytic converter or mid-pipe using the provided clamps or flanges. Use new gaskets or sealant to prevent leaks. Secure the pipes to the rubber hangers and tighten bolts incrementally to allow alignment adjustments.
6. Align and Tighten
Once the full system is in place and aligned evenly, tighten all clamps and bolts to the manufacturer’s specified torque settings. Ensure the exhaust tips are centered and evenly spaced within the bumper cutouts.
7. Inspect for Leaks and Clearances
Start the engine and check for exhaust leaks around joints and connections. Listen for unusual noises or rattling. Confirm that the pipes have adequate clearance from the vehicle’s underbody and suspension components to avoid heat damage or vibrations.
8. Final Adjustments
If necessary, make minor adjustments to the exhaust tip placement or hanger tension. Re-check all fasteners after a short test drive to ensure nothing has loosened.
Safety Precautions for Exhaust Installation
Working on your vehicle’s exhaust system involves potential hazards. Follow these safety tips to minimize risks:
- Wear protective gear: Always use safety goggles to protect your eyes from debris, gloves to protect your hands from sharp edges and hot surfaces, and durable clothing.
- Work in a ventilated area: Exhaust fumes are toxic. Perform installation outdoors or in a well-ventilated garage.
- Use proper vehicle support: Always use jack stands or ramps to securely support your vehicle. Never rely on a hydraulic jack alone.
- Disconnect the battery: If your exhaust system includes electronic components such as valves or sensors, disconnect the battery to prevent electrical shorts.
- Handle hot components carefully: Allow the exhaust system to cool completely before beginning work to avoid burns.
- Follow manufacturer instructions: Adhere closely to the kit’s installation manual. Improper installation can lead to exhaust leaks, reduced performance, or damage.
Additional Tips for Enhancing Your Quad Exhaust Upgrade
Beyond the basic installation, consider these tips to maximize the benefits of your quad exhaust upgrade:
1. Tune Your Engine
Upgrading your exhaust can alter airflow and backpressure, which might affect engine performance. Consider having your vehicle tuned or remapped to optimize fuel delivery and ignition timing, unlocking additional power gains.
2. Upgrade Supporting Components
For the best results, pair your quad exhaust with other performance modifications such as a high-flow catalytic converter, cold air intake, or performance headers. These components work synergistically to improve engine breathing.
3. Maintain Your Exhaust System
Regularly inspect your exhaust for signs of corrosion, loose clamps, or damage. Cleaning the exhaust tips and keeping the undercarriage free of road salt can prolong the life of your system.
4. Consider Heat Wrapping
Wrapping exhaust pipes with heat-resistant wrap can reduce under-hood temperatures, protect nearby components, and improve exhaust gas velocity for better performance.
Common Challenges and How to Overcome Them
Even with a well-prepared DIY enthusiast, some challenges may arise during a quad exhaust upgrade. Here are common issues and solutions:
Fitment Issues
If pipes don’t align perfectly, double-check all measurements before cutting. Use adjustable clamps or pipe expanders to help fit components together. For universal kits, some modification may be inevitable.
Exhaust Leaks
Leaks often occur at joints and flanges. Ensure gaskets are properly seated and use exhaust sealant where recommended. Tighten clamps incrementally and retighten after initial engine heat cycles.
Noise or Drone
If you experience excessive drone at certain RPMs, consider adding resonators or aftermarket mufflers designed to reduce unwanted sound frequencies.
Corrosion and Rust
Using stainless steel components minimizes corrosion risk. Regularly inspect and clean your exhaust, especially if you live in areas with heavy road salt use.
